About Heckfield Estates
The Heckfield estate, set across 438 acres, contains a certified biodynamic market garden, organic farm, woodlands, ornamental gardens, and pleasure grounds. The market garden and farm, known as Heckfield Home Farm, grows produce and flowers for its sister companies Heckfield Place, Spring, and Wildsmith Skin, along with produce sales held on the farm. The mixed livestock and arable farm is home to a herd of beef cattle, flocks of sheep, saddleback pigs, hens, and a dairy herd of Guernsey cows, whose milk is processed on site in the dairy processing unit.

We are now looking for a Market Garden & Plant Nursery Supervisor to join our growing team, to assist the Head Market Gardener in the successful planning, propagation, production, and day‑to‑day management of a productive market garden. The role combines hands‑on crop growing expertise with day to day supervision of the team, ensuring crops are raised to a high standard from seed through to harvest while leading the garden team effectively.
This is a plant‑centred role, requiring strong propagation skills, sound horticultural knowledge, and the ability to make informed growing decisions based on close observation of crops and prevailing conditions.
This is a physical role based outdoors throughout the seasons therefore the ideal candidate must be comfortable working in all weather conditions and be physically fit.

About Heckfield Park Farm Limited
The market garden is set over 5 acres, with a large state-of-the-art propagating glasshouse and five polytunnels supporting the vegetable and soft fruit growing, that supply the hotel's two restaurants with beautiful, truly seasonal and delicious produce. There is a young orchard, with more than 500 apple, pear and stoned fruit trees, which is home to our bees and organic chickens. The market garden certified organic and currently in Year 3 conversion to full biodynamic certification.
